I remember one summer when I was about ten, my family went on a road trip around Scotland. We visited Edinburgh, Loch Ness, and Inverness, and I distinctly remember playing mini-golf at a seaside town along the way. It was my first experience of golf on a proper course and I loved it.
As I got older, golf became more than just a hobby for me. I started to take it more seriously and practice regularly. I took lessons from a local pro and entered junior tournaments. It became clear to me that golf was something I was passionate about and wanted to excel in.
I continued to play golf throughout my teenage years and into adulthood. I played for my college team and even competed in regional competitions. Golf was a big part of my life and provided me with a sense of accomplishment and pride.
After college, I joined a local golf club and started playing regularly with a group of friends. We would compete against each other, wagering on the outcome of our games. Golf became a way for us to bond and challenge ourselves.
Eventually, I decided to join a more prestigious golf club, Wetherby Golf Club. It was a step up for me, but I was determined to improve my game and compete at a higher level. I dedicated more time to practicing and honing my skills on the course.
Golf has taught me many valuable lessons over the years. It has taught me patience, discipline, and perseverance. It has also taught me the importance of good sportsmanship and respect for the game.
Today, golf is still a big part of my life. I play regularly at Wetherby Golf Club, entering tournaments and competing against other members. I continue to challenge myself and push myself to improve my skills on the course.
Golf is not just a sport for me, it is a way of life. It has given me friendships, memories, and a sense of purpose. I am grateful for the opportunities and experiences that golf has provided me and I look forward to many more years of playing this wonderful game.
